We want your knowledge and expertise!Job Summary and QualificationsThe Case Manager (CM) ensures high-quality, patient-centered care by managing Rehabilitative care to ensure optimum outcomes. The CM provides, coordinates, and directs care specific to the needs of each Rehab patient. The CM collaborates with the Rehab Program Director and Facility Case Management Director regarding departmental functions. The CM coordinates efforts within the Rehabilitation team.What you will do in this role:

You will provide program orientation to patients/families/caregivers. Orientation will include the case manager's role, Rehab philosophy, and continued stay and discharge criteria. Orientation will also include Medicare and insurance benefits, grievance procedures, treatment plan process, and rights and responsibilities.

You will act as the coordinator of patient/family/caregiver education. You will promote the participation of the patient/family/caregiver in team discussions related to plans, goals, and status. This will be conducted through Family Conferences and other interactions.

You will ensure the implementation of the patient's treatment plan that supports the patient's strengths, abilities, needs, and preferences. You will facilitate the involvement of the patient throughout the rehabilitation process.

You will document the findings of the Discharge Planning Evaluation (DPE) and psychosocial assessments. You will communicate the social, financial, or discharge needs and preferences of the patient/family/caregiver.

Heart Hospital of Austin (https://austinheart.com/) , which is part of St. David’sHealthCare, is a 58-bed hospital. We are one of the highest performing cardiovascularfacilities in the nation. We specialize in the diagnosis and treatment of cardiovascular disease.It features a comprehensive 24-hour emergency department. We have an advanced Executive WellnessProgram. Our six operating rooms (ORs), including three hybrid ORs serve the city of Austin. We havethree catheterization labs and electrophysiology services as well.
